Ex hasn't is self employed but has not paid tax for 5 years

Hello, i was wondering if anyone could help. My ex is self employed and has worked as a long term freelancer for the same company as well as doing odd jobs on the side. He has not paid tax for over 5 years though. He recently refused to keep paying maintenance which was agreed between us personally fo rout two children  and so I had to go through the child maintance service in order to get him to support our children financially however they have calcualted a generic amount that he has to pay due to the fact that they do not have any information from HRMC  to go on which is much less then he should be paying. Does anyone know what the next step is and how I get the correct amount without any information from the HRMC to  go on?

    You can report him to HMRC on 0800 788 887 and they might investigate his tax affairs. It would be best to give them some evidence of his income even if this is only historical evidence.
